Pegatron Plant Explosion Injures Dozens, Could Affect iPad 2/3 Production.

A Shanghai based assembly plant belonging to Pegatron subsidiary, Riteng, reportedly exploded late Saturday (local time) injuring 50+ people and possibly affecting ongoing iPad 2 production as well as upcoming iPad 3 production too. The plant is said to have been producing back panels for iPad 2s, and is currently testing production for an “unspecified product” (read: ipad 3) based on reports from a local paper, the “Yi Cai Daily”. Apple Having Trademark Issues Of Their Own, Doesn’t Own “iPad” Trademark In China.

Similar to RIM’s own ongoing issue with losing the “BBX” trademark to BASIS International Ltd., Apple is apparently experiencing their own licensing snafu. As it currently stands, Apple could be forced to sell the iPad under a new name should Chinese company, Proview Technology, emerge victories in ongoing lawsuits with Apple.
